Output 08a5cd08e0db62eeec7020f2bf4a6fed6887cdb01bc8a424ee073e17a6b59697:1

value
628914824
script pubkey
OP_0 OP_PUSHBYTES_20 cc8db1de34fb5efb0e748300bcef7df1a1d24319
address
bc1qejxmrh35ld00krn5svqtemma7xsaysceh78euq
transaction
08a5cd08e0db62eeec7020f2bf4a6fed6887cdb01bc8a424ee073e17a6b59697
confirmations
20510
spent
true